Sweep them off their feet with QUEEN OF HEARTS, a luxurious hand-tied rose bouquet from Flower Delivery Whetstone. Enchanting red and white roses are artfully arranged with rich red hypericum, delicate red gypsophila and lush greenery to create a truly romantic surprise. Perfect for Valentine's Day, anniversaries or any moment you want to say "I love you" in style.

Each bouquet is delivered in bud to ensure up to 5 days of freshness, so you can watch the roses gradually open and fill the room with beauty. A stylish vase is included for maximum display impact, making this a complete, ready-to-enjoy gift. Our expert Whetstone florists carefully select every stem and leave the natural guard petals on the roses to protect the inner blooms during transit; simply peel them away on arrival for a flawless finish.

With next-day flower delivery in Whetstone available on orders placed before 4 pm, QUEEN OF HEARTS is the perfect last-minute gesture that still feels thoughtful and premium. Due to seasonal availability, some flowers may be substituted with blooms of similar colour, size and value, ensuring your bouquet always looks full and luxurious.
